Abstract

fetched live from OpenAlex

En la actualidad, todavía hay profesionales del ámbito de la Biblioteconomía y Documentación que no conocen su papel en el desarrollo de la Web Semántica, en especial en lo concerniente a las ontologías. Este trabajo pretende contribuir a aclarar este asunto de dos maneras: en primer lugar, identificando las principales tendencias, temas y problemas tratados en la investigación sobre ontologías y, en segundo lugar, identificando las posibles contribuciones del área de la Biblioteconomía y Documentación al desarrollo de ontologías para la Web Semántica. Para ello, se presenta en primer lugar una revisión de literatura basada en búsquedas en bases de datos de cobertura internacional (LISA, SCI, SSCI, ACM Digital Library e IEEE Explore). A continuación, y a partir de dicha revisión, se presenta una discusión de las principales tendencias, temas y problemas identificados. Finalmente, se presentan recomendaciones sobre posibles contribuciones del área documental al desarrollo de ontologías para la Web Semántica.
